March 13th, 2015: Big Shiny Truck

If you're ever in need of a full-sized replica of a big truck with twenty two people and rearview mirrors which play videos of traffic in London, Mumbai and Dubai, you're in luck. Valay Shende can, and has, whipped one up by welding pieces of stainless steel together in only 18 months.



Haven't been able to find out how many pieces of stainless but it's a lot.



Colossal says,

Quote:
Shende conceived of Transit as commentary on a dramatic rash of farmer suicides in India over the last decade.
